About The Dorchester Hotel

The Dorchester Hotel is set in a conservation area on Beverley Road, just one mile from Hull city centre. The hotel was first built as 3 separate houses between 1863 and 1869 and still has much of its original character. Originally the Dorchester House, Tamworth Lodge and Stanley House, the latter was converted in 1937 into a guest house and by 1958, all 3 houses had merged to form a 58 bedroom hotel named The Dorchester. In 2002, The Dorchester underwent a major refurbishment and modernisation, not only bringing it back to its former glory and traditional style, but back to its original concept. Then in October 2006, the hotel was taken over by its current owners who gave it another refurbishment. Now operating as a 25 bedroom hotel incorporating the Sullivan's bar and restaurant, the Tamworth function suite and the Expressions night club; this is a building that has everything.
